D. Linnaeus primarily used physical characteristics.
Brief Explanations:
Linnaeus classified organisms mainly by physical traits. Modern - day understanding considers more factors like genetics and evolutionary relationships, making some of his classifications incorrect as they didn't account for these deeper - level aspects.
